How do I delete my Bank Account?

You can delete your bank accounts by removing them from your Bank Transactions screen or marking them as inactive in your Chart of Accounts.Â
Disconnect a bank account from the Bank transactions screen
If you want to stop an account from appearing on your Bank transactions screen, you can disconnect it. While the account will no longer be visible on this screen, it will remain active in your Accounting tab.
Pre-requisites
- Ensure you are on the Bank transactions tab.
Steps to disconnect
- Go to All apps
, select Accounting, then select Bank transactions (Take me there). - Select the bank account tile you want to delete.
- Select the Pencil icon on the top right of the account.
- Select Edit Account Info.
- Scroll to the bottom and tick the Disconnect this Account on Save box.
- Select Save and Close.
The account is removed from the Bank transactions screen view but remains active in the Accounting tab.
Make a bank account inactive in the chart of accounts
For a more permanent solution than disconnecting, you can make the account inactive.
| Speak to your accountant before taking this action to ensure your financial records remain accurate. |
